If you’re in the mood for a comforting, home‑style turkey dish with minimal fuss yet maximum flavour, then turkey the Amish way is for you. Inspired by simple, hearty Amish cooking traditions, this version uses a turkey breast bathed in maple syrup, apple cider vinegar and mustard, slowly cooked until fall‑apart tender. How this turkey the Amish way delivers ease & flavour
You simply place the turkey breast and sauce mixture into the slow cooker and leave it for hours. The hands‑on time is only about 15 minutes, but the payoff is a dish that tastes like you worked on it all day. Great for busy weeks, guest dinners or making ahead.
